Who Else's TL didnt start today?

So, i fell victim to the common "Acura Battery Quality"

i've got a company car this week, so my acura didnt move for about 20 hours(very rare, i drive all day every day)....friggin 2008...only 22k, battery cant start in cold weather...thats ridiculous...

i came home at 6pm to switch cars, the TL was dead as a noornail.. i jumped it, and its started 4 times already tonight... FYI, it was 28 degrees this morning in NY... coldest day yet


Should i have Acura give me a new battery? or should i shell out $200+ for a Braille

i just put a new optima redtop in my jeep a few weeks ago, and this morning started with NO problems at all, and no hesitation. im going to put a new optima battery in my acura but im still undecided between the yellow/red top. my system isnt crazy at all so im probably going with the red cause of the CCA(720) and CA(910) as opposed to the yellow which is 650 CCA and 810 CA
